Your team's knowledge is buried in Slack threads nobody can find again.
Cognee and Qdrant are teaming up for an evening of building. We'll show you how to build a memory and retrieval system on top of your Slack workspace. The system ingests conversations, detects patterns and turns them into agentic SKILLs. Each SKILL retrieves the most relevant context for your task and builds structured memory on top of your unstructured data.
What you'll build
Working in small teams (or solo, if you prefer), you'll wire up Cognee's memory engine with Qdrant's vector search to give a Slack workspace real recall. By the end of the night you will:
Ingest messages and threads from a Slack export or live workspaceStructure that history into queryable memoryAnswer questions a plain keyword search never could

About Qdrant:
Qdrant is an open-source vector search engine built to handle high-dimensional data at scale. It powers the retrieval layer behind some of the most demanding AI applications in production today, from RAG pipelines to recommendation systems to AI agents, giving developers fast, accurate similarity search wherever it's needed.
About Cognee:
Cognee is an open-source AI memory engine that transforms unstructured data into persistent, queryable memory. It enables AI agents to store, retrieve, and reason over information across time and infrastructure, making it possible to build reliable, adaptive, and stateful AI systems that operate seamlessly across cloud and local environments.
